С Новым годом! Форум программистов, компьютерный форум, киберфорум
Наши страницы

найти значение третьего по величине элемента массива - C++

Войти
Регистрация
Восстановить пароль
Другие темы раздела
C++ Заголовочные файлы http://www.cyberforum.ru/cpp-beginners/thread654982.html
Добрый день. Вот такой вопрос. Пишу на Борланде. Не пойму как писать, если классы помещать в свои файлы. Вот например, программа
C++ Волновой алгоритм поиска пути Добрый день. Реализую всем известный алгоритм поиска кратчайшего пути. Но не могу понять одну вещь. Пройдя волновым методам по соседним клеткам нахожу конечную точку. Матрица тоже заполнена: ... http://www.cyberforum.ru/cpp-beginners/thread654951.html
Расчет сумм в формуле и расчет xi должны быть оформлены в виде отдельных функций. C++
День добрый товарищи специалисты, помогите пожалуйста с примером m=((1/n)*\sum_{i=1}^{n}{x}_{i}){}^{2}-\sum_{i=1}^{n}{x}_{i} ,n=5 ф-ция {x}_{i}=cos(i)+2i. Расчет сумм в формуле и расчет xi должны...
C++ Найти числа, сумма цифр каждого из которых в некоторой степени дает это же число
Народ, помогите сделать, только начал изучать программирование :-"Найти все натуральные числа, не превосходящие 99999, сумма цифр каждого из которых в некоторой степени дает это число...
C++ Строки, динамическая память, обрезка строк http://www.cyberforum.ru/cpp-beginners/thread654935.html
Доброго времени суток... Вот задача на дом 2. Показать на экран с m по n символов строки, введенной пользователем и записать данный отрезок в другой массив. (m и n также вводятся пользователем) ...
C++ Проблемка с компиляцией (MinGW) Есть #include <stdio.h> int main() { printf( "hello\n" ); return 0; } Есть APP = main CFL = -m32 -march=i686 -c LFL = -m32 -march=i686 -s -static подробнее

Показать сообщение отдельно
soon
2542 / 1307 / 81
Регистрация: 09.05.2011
Сообщений: 3,086
Записей в блоге: 1
20.09.2012, 17:32
C++
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
#include <iostream>
#include <array>
#include <algorithm>
#include <functional>
 
int main()
{
    std::array<int, 10> a{4, 2, 7, 1, 8, 0, 3, 5, 9, 6};
    std::partial_sort
    (
        a.begin(),
        a.begin() + 3,
        a.end(),
        std::greater<decltype(a)::value_type>()
    );
    std::cout << a[2] << std::endl;
    return 0;
}
Добавлено через 5 минут
Логичнее запихнуть в set, пожалуй.
3
 
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2017, vBulletin Solutions, Inc.